Gentler Than a Breeze

 

Gentler Than a Breeze: An Episode from Imam Khomeini’s Life (Peace be Upon Him)

Corresponding Authors: Mohammad Reza Bayrami, Susan Taqdis, Ahmad Arabloo and Mohammad Naseri

Number of Pages: 176

 

The present collection is a humble attempt to represent grandeur and vastness of the details of an ocean. The episodes of the present collection resemble those tiny streams that depicts the magnificent of their origin, which is Imam Khomeini’s rich life story (peace be upon him). The episodes of the collection represent true incidents of the life of his holiness. Being ingrained in the minds of his disciples, these precious episodes are materialized in this collection so that they could depict the humble artistic loyalty to the memories of Imam Khomeini (peace be upon him). Constituted of 99 short stories, the present collection could be utilized as an ebullient fountain for incorporeal fulfillment of adolescent generation of the country. Covering the incidents of 1978, the present collection represents social, ethical and behavioral traits of the late leader of the Islamic Republic of Iran so that adolescent and youth generations of the country can salvage from the ocean of learning of his holiness.
